Acne Medication Market Size and Manufacturers

The global acne medication market size was valued at USD 11.57 billion in 2023 and is predicted to reach around USD 19.17 billion by 2033 with a CAGR of 5.18% from 2024 to 2033.

Acne Medication Market Overview

The acne medication market refers to the pharmaceutical and over-the-counter (OTC) products designed to treat and manage acne, a common skin condition characterized by the presence of pimples, blackheads, whiteheads, and inflammation on the skin. Acne medications encompass a wide range of topical and oral treatments, including prescription medications, over-the-counter creams and gels, cleansers, and spot treatments.

Adapalene is one of the types of medication that is used in the treatment of acne problems. It comes in a gel or cream formulation. Benzoyl peroxide is another type of acne medication that destroys or reduces the amount of bacteria in acne. Changing lifestyles, sleeping and eating habits, higher consumption of junk and oily food, rising environmental pollution, and bad weather conditions are collectively impacting human health and skin, which results in increasing skin diseases like acne that boost the demand for acne medication and drive the growth of the acne medication market.

Restraint: Side effects

Similar to several other medications prescribed for cosmetic and medical use, acne medications result in a wide range of adverse reactions ranging from mild local irritation to systemic side effects such as liver dysfunctions. Depending on individual cases has been reported wherein side effects such as vomiting, nausea, or diarrhea were reported on the use of acne medication. This can hamper the growth of the acne medication market.

Product Insights

The antibiotics segment dominated the acne medication market in 2023. The rising adoption of antibiotics as a treatment for acne due to their higher efficiency is drives the growth of the antibiotics segment. Antibiotics come in two types: topical and oral. Antibiotics are highly used in acne treatment because they help to reduce the amount of bacteria, inflammation, and swelling and minimize the risk of scars. Tetracycline and erythromycin are antibiotics that can help reduce the extreme pain of acne, which is related to bacteria on the skin. Thus, the higher adoption of antibiotics in acne treatment drives the growth of the antibiotics segment.

The retinoid segment is expected to grow at a notable rate in the acne medication market during the forecast period. The growth of the segment is expected to increase due to the rising demand for retinoids to help reduce mild acne and enhance the skin's appearance. Retinol generally comes in gels, serums, lotions, wipes, and creams. Retinol is commonly found in every kind of skincare product, including anti-acne and anti-aging products. Retinol is applied to the skin once per day after cleaning the face for 20 or 30 minutes. There are some other benefits associated with the use of retinol, such as anti-aging, minimizing fine lines and wrinkles, reducing pigmentation, increasing skin elasticity, and enhancing skin tone and texture. All these factors are contributing to the demand for retinol in the acne medication market.

Routes of Administration Insights

The topical segment held the largest share of the acne medication market in 2023. The growth of the segment is attributed to the rising adoption of topical solutions due to their easy availability and soothing nature. Topical retinoids like adapalene or tretinoin are considered the most effective method for the treatment of comedonal acne. Topical antibiotics like azelaic acid and benzoyl peroxide are used in the inflammatory condition of acne. Topical treatments are considered the sole treatment for acne in many patients and are used as part of the therapeutic regimen.

The oral segment is expected to grow at the fastest pace in the acne medication market during the anticipated period. The rising adoption of oral administration of acne medication due to its effectiveness and treatment within the body is driving the demand for the oral administration of the drug. Oral medicine is prescribed by the doctor in the case of moderate to severe acne problems, and acne does not respond to the topical treatment. The segment includes oral antibiotics, accutane (isotretinoin), oral contraceptives, and Aldactone (spironolactone). In which oral contraceptives and Aldactone are used in acne related to the menstrual cycles.

Recent Developments

  • In February 2024, VA-based med spa gentle wellness center, “Fairfax,” launched the Morpheus8 skin resurfacing treatment for people who are suffering from scar tissue from dermatological disorders.
  • In January 2024, Bausch Health Companies Inc. and Ortho Dermatologics, its dermatology business, introduces the CABTREO™ (clindamycin, adapalene, benzoyl peroxide) topical gel, 1.2%/0.15%/3.1% in the U.S. for the topical treatment of acne vulgaries for the 12 years and above age patients.
